You have an unusual set of parts.
Exactly what is the purpose for this pc?
If it is for gaming, what is your proposed monitor setup?

In a well ventilated case, I see little need for liquid cooling, and a lot of con's.
More noise, expense, risk with very little gain.
The added potential of liquid cooling is perhaps 5%
The 4770K is a very competent cpu at stock. With a conservative oc it is hard to imagine you might need more.

What kind of raid are you thinking of?
What do you plan to accomplish?
As a rule, raid on a desktop is not worth it.
